Job Description: The Role We are looking for a Buying Intelligence Analyst on a 12 month FTC. This role is a central part of Buying and Buying Operations at TJX Europe, it requires an independent, high-level viewpoint and operates at pace while working closely with partners across the business. The Buying Intelligence Analyst needs to be able to work in a fast‑paced environment helping to deliver business‑critical reports and analysis. They will be responsible for providing analytical and statistical reporting for the wider Buying community whilst remaining flexible to business need. The individual must be highly motivated, be able to use their initiative to decipher complex information, produce ad‑hoc reports/ information as well as delivering trend analysis and data that inform and support business decision making and strategy. The role offers an opportunity to be exposed to AVPs, VPs and the SVP’s of Buying, as well as a chance to build relationships with partners in IT, Finance, Merchandising and Logistics. The analyst within this team will gain a unique insight into the topline trading of the business.

Responsibilities
  • Accountable for providing regular reporting to the Buying team and the wider by working collaboratively with the Buying Operations Business Partner and other functions (i.e. logistics, merchandising, finance etc.)
  • Develop, deliver and analyse reports in collaboration with the Buying Operations team, the wider Buying Community and cross functional Business Partners
  • Deliver ad‑hoc reporting for business needs with pace and agility. Maintaining a flexible approach re‑prioritising where appropriate with Buying Intelligence Manager to deliver workload
  • Support, drive and deliver Buying Operations RPA strategy
  • Provide updates on progress of initiatives
  • Communicate, update and support teams across Global Buying Offices
  • Identify trends and opportunities in historic reporting as well as the wider market to forecast and analyse future trends
  • Build and develop relationships with Business Partners throughout the organisation
  • Build presentations, updates and meeting support material for the Buying Operations team
  • Ability to prioritise and execute the daily activities in a timely manner whilst remaining flexible to business need.
  • Support the execution of the future strategy of the function
  • Be responsible for output logs for Robotics, being the point person for escalation and resolve issues as necessary.
  • Be supportive and reactive to all on‑going projects and changes within the Business needs; attention to detail and using your own initiative to drive results.
Qualifications
  • Strong analytical mind with advanced Excel and PowerQuery skills
  • Demonstratable knowledge of multiple platforms (e.g Power BI, creating and enhancing dashboards, SharePoint)
  • Strategic and curious mindset
  • Stakeholder presentations - Powerpoint
  • Storytelling through data
  • Broad thinking
  • Ability to balance structure of weekly routines along with ad‑hoc needs.
  • Attention to detail to be able to proof accuracy of reporting and problem solve errors.
  • Capacity to work independently to prioritize and execute all required weekly/monthly tasks to a good standard and within deadlines.
  • Be able to partner closely with the Buying Intelligence team to offer support to the other analyst(s), as well as the wider team with varying ad‑hoc and weekly tasks.
  • Drives own development; has an awareness of their own development areas and come along to 1 to 1's with reflections, strengths, and areas of improvement to help build their own self‑awareness.
  • Ability to interpret data and present as relevant information, tailored to the specific audience
  • Strong interpersonal & both verbal and written communication skills
  • Understanding of Buying, Logistics, PC's and Store processes (top line)
